Enabling debugging or profiling in the web inspector causes Webkit to crash on
my system. This happens regardless of the URL. Other features in the web
inspector seem to work as expected, but Webkit crashes within a few seconds of
enabling profiling or debugging. I've tried reseting preferences.
I have a first run unibody MacBook Pro with 4GB of RAM, (I get the extensions
warning) I also have the Safari 4 beta installed.
Console doesn't yield much:
5/9/09 12:04:05 AM Safari[39964] WebKit r43392 initialized.
5/9/09 12:09:24 AM com.apple.launchd[96]
([0x0-0x647647].org.webkit.nightly.WebKit[39964]) Exited abnormally:
Segmentation fault
5/9/09 12:09:28 AM Safari[39984] WebKit failed to shut down cleanly. Checking
for Safari extensions.
5/9/09 12:09:28 AM Safari[39984] WebKit r43392 initialized.
